Factors to Consider Before Opting for a Luxury Car Loan:
3.1 Loan Amount and Eligibility:
Before embarking on the luxury car loan journey, assess your financial standing and determine the loan amount you require. Ensure that you meet the eligibility criteria set by lenders, including factors such as credit score, income, and employment stability.
3.2 Down Payment:
While luxury car loans may require a smaller down payment compared to the vehicle’s total cost, it is important to evaluate your financial capability to make a down payment. A larger down payment can reduce your loan amount and subsequent EMI burden.

3.3 Loan Tenure:
Consider the tenure of the loan carefully. Longer loan tenures may reduce the EMI amount but increase the total interest paid over the loan term. Shorter tenures may result in higher EMIs but can save you money on interest in the long run. Choose a tenure that balances your monthly cash flow and minimizes the overall cost of borrowing.

3.4 Credit Score:
Maintaining a healthy credit score is crucial when applying for any loan. A good credit score not only increases your chances of loan approval but also helps secure better interest rates. Pay your existing debts on time, avoid defaults, and monitor your credit report regularly to ensure your credit score remains in good standing.

Prepayment and Foreclosure:

Luxury car loan EMI plans often provide the option for prepayment or foreclosure, allowing borrowers to pay off their loans before the scheduled tenure. Prepayment can help reduce the interest paid and the overall loan duration. However, some lenders may impose prepayment charges, so it’s essential to understand the terms and conditions before making any early payments.
